In this paper, the bit-sensitivity of H.264 bitstream has been studied firstly, to determine the most significant bits for video reconstruction. On this basis, an efficient video encryption scheme in H.264 compressed domain is presented. In the proposed scheme, the most significant bits in H.264 bitstream are directly extracted to be encrypted, including the codewords of intra-prediction modes, motion vector difference (MVD) and the sign bits of the low frequency DCT coefficients of intra-frames. Experimental results show that the proposed encryption scheme exhibits reliable perceptual security, can secure against not only replacement attacks but also brute-force attacks, and achieves significant computational efficiency. Furthermore, it maintains the format-compliance to the H.264 standard decoder and has no impact on the compression efficiency. © 2011 AICIT.
